Transaction 89c1717fd2c48f3a2e08703132fc1c38e58e2a97d3f1ecfc796769e615cb2dec
1 Input
1 Output
-
89c1717fd2c48f3a2e08703132fc1c38e58e2a97d3f1ecfc796769e615cb2dec:0
- value
- 22043543
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c42524da781da0cd62e7ba4cab07125fa743c1e OP_EQUAL
- address
- 37Bdv9mbZLXZqjTURuqnEhaA7xTVbHsntY